What Is Natural Rubber?
Natural rubber, including SMR (Standard Malaysian Rubber), is derived from the milky white sap (latex) that flows from the rubber tree when the bark is cut in a process called “tapping.” SMR represents a globally recognized grading system for technically specified rubber, ensuring quality and consistency.

Natural rubber begins its life as latex, a milky white fluid harvested from the Hevea brasiliensis tree. This remarkable substance contains rubber particles suspended in water, along with small amounts of proteins, resins, sugars, and minerals. Application of Natural Rubber Across Industries
Natural rubber plays a vital role in a wide range of industries, thanks to its unmatched elasticity, durability, and adaptability. From automotive components to medical devices and everyday consumer goods, it delivers performance where it matters most.
Automobile
Natural rubber is a critical component in automotive manufacturing, used in the production of tires, hoses, belts, and seals.
Healthcare
In the healthcare sector, it is commonly used in surgical gloves, catheters, adhesive bandages, and medical tubing.
Industrial
SMR has many industrial uses because of its resilience, such as conveyor belts, vibration isolators, seismic bearings, and industrial adhesives.
Retail
Natural rubber enhances comfort and functionality in everyday products such as footwear, sports equipment, toys, and mattresses.
